Sludgineers Battles Pollution With the Release of Steam Demo

Make It Shine in Sludgineers

Indie developers Snickerdoodle Games and Funk Games have released a public demo for their upcoming title Sludgineers, now available on Steam for PC, Mac, and Linux. The game introduces a calm, engaging take on the incremental genre, blending light resource management with hands-on pollution cleanup.

Sludgineers

Sludgineers places players in a countryside setting where the main goal revolves around clearing environmental waste while steadily building a profitable operation. Players begin by collecting and cleaning polluted materials, then move on to refining and processing them into useful resources. As progress builds, earnings can be reinvested into constructing a refinery, upgrading equipment, and unlocking more efficient tools.

The gameplay focuses on a steady sense of growth, allowing players to expand their capabilities over time. New areas gradually open up, each offering fresh opportunities and challenges, while a variety of quests guide progression and add structure to the experience. The game maintains a relaxing pace throughout, making it accessible while still rewarding consistent play.

In addition to its core mechanics, Sludgineers includes support for 14 languages, helping it reach a wider audience. With its mix of cleanup mechanics, incremental progression, and light exploration, the demo offers a clear look at what players can expect from the full release.

The Sludgineers demo is available now on Steam, giving players an early chance to explore its systems and experience its satisfying gameplay loop.
